Lightweight Stretch Outer Shell Materials
Stretch-infused fabrics are the top material choice to boost dexterity in ski gloves, warm gloves, and cold-proof gloves.
4-Way Stretch Nylon/Spandex Blend is the most popular dexterity-friendly shell material. It delivers windproof and snow-resistant performance while stretching with every finger bend and fist closure. Unlike rigid heavy oxford cloth, this blend doesn’t restrict hand movement, perfect for adult ski gloves and children's ski gloves that need flexibility for gripping ski poles, adjusting helmets, or handling small gear.
Softshell Polyester Ripstop is another premium option. It’s thin, lightweight, abrasion-resistant, and naturally flexible without bulky layers. Ski gloves from a reliable Chinese factory of ski gloves frequently use this material because it balances cold protection and unrestricted finger mobility.
Low-Bulk High-Recovery Insulation Materials
Traditional thick cotton padding ruins dexterity, while these specialized insulating materials keep hands warm without bulk:
3M Thinsulate Ultra Thin Insulation is the gold standard. It traps body heat with ultra-fine microfibers in a slim profile, no puffiness, allowing full finger flexion. It stays compressible and bounces back to shape instantly, so hands never feel stiff or restricted.
Primaloft Gold/Silver Synthetic Insulation is lightweight, water-resistant, and low-volume. It mimics down’s warmth but stays slim, preserving dexterity even in freezing temperatures. It won’t clump or harden, keeping gloves flexible all day long.
Micro Polyester Loft Insulation is a budget-friendly dexterity pick—fine, tightly woven fibers offer warmth with minimal thickness, ideal for casual cold-proof gloves that still need natural hand movement.
Slim Flexible Palm & Liner Materials
These materials improve grip without stiffness:
Thin Stretch Synthetic PU Leather (ultra-thin version) molds naturally to the hand, soft and bendable, delivering anti-slip grip without the rigid feel of thick leather. It’s the go-to palm material for high-dexterity adult and children's ski gloves.
Lightweight Brushed Jersey Liner & Micro Fleece are smooth, thin, and low-friction liners. They slide easily against hand skin and glove layers, letting fingers move freely. Thick plush fleece kills dexterity, but these slim liners add warmth while keeping flexibility intact.
Silicone Printed Anti-Slip Coating instead of thick rubber pads: thin silicone dots add grip on ski poles without adding material thickness or stiffness, maintaining full dexterity for fine motor tasks.
Elastic Cuff & Seam Materials
Elastic Spandex Rib Knit at cuffs stretches naturally, doesn’t constrict wrists, and allows full wrist rotation. Flatlock seam fabric materials eliminate bulky raised stitching inside gloves, removing pressure points that limit finger movement—another key detail used by professional Chinese factory of ski gloves for high-dexterity ski gloves designs.
